If this is true, why have they not told everyone yet? Are they hoping that when its announced they'll look like grand heroes who saved the day, and 'we had you going all along!'? It just seems like PR suicide to me.
Still, it'll be great if it is true.
Captcha: Hello sweetie.
Yes.....hello, Captcha.....
Still, it'll be great if it is true.
Captcha: Hello sweetie.
Yes.....hello, Captcha.....